Key Challenges Solved by Beagle
Blind Spots in Detection Systems
Security and fraud controls often operate in silos, across the customer journey. They are rarely tested together. Beagle simulates multi-layered attacks across touchpoints, to uncover weak links throughout your digital estate.
Manual and Infrequent Red-Teaming
Traditional fraud testing is resource-intensive and often performed too late. Beagle automates fraud simulations on a regular cadence, providing continuous feedback with zero manual upkeep.
Failure to Detect Sophisticated Threats
Beagle mimics real-world adversaries using techniques like credential stuffing, synthetic identity creation, and behavioral mimicry, helping you validate whether your systems can detect advanced, evasive tactics.
Fragmented Journey Visibility
Beagle deeply integrates with Darwinium’s journey-based configuration model, correlating each simulation step with your defined flows, with full event logs for every test run.
Slow Remediation Loops
Most fraud teams struggle to translate test results into detection improvements. Beagle annotates journeys, suggests features or rule updates, and helps auto-remediate where gaps are found.
Inability to Simulate Diverse Fraud Vectors
From bot attacks and account takeover to identity theft and content abuse, Beagle tests a broad range of fraud scenarios in both web and API environments.
